Step 1: Assessment and Containment

Our team will arrive at your property and assess the damage. We’ll identify the source of the leak, contain the affected area, and begin extracting water using our truck-mounted pumps.

Step 2: Water Extraction and Drying

Once the water is contained, our technicians will extract the water using our powerful pumps. We’ll use specialized equipment to dry the affected area, including fans and dehumidifiers to speed up the process.

Step 3: Cleaning and Sanitizing

After the water is removed and the area is dry, we’ll clean and sanitize the affected area to prevent any further damage or health risks. Our technicians will use specialized cleaning solutions and equipment to get the job done right.

Step 4: Restoration and Rebuilding

Once the cleaning and sanitizing process is complete, we’ll begin the restoration and rebuilding process. This may include repairing or replacing damaged walls, floors, and ceilings. Our team will work with you to get your property back to its original state.

Emergency Water Extraction Cost In Scituate, MA

Prices for emergency water extraction vary based on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Scituate, MA. These are estimates, not guarantees. We’ll provide a free estimate after assessing the damage on-site.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ction and Dr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area and severity of damage
Cleaning and Sanitizing $200 – $1,000 Type of cleaning solutions and equipment used
Restoration and Rebuilding $1,000 – $5,000 Scope of repairs and materials needed
Mold Remediation $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area and type of mold
Dehumidification and Air Drying $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area and type of equipment used

Exact pricing depends on the specifics of your situation. We’ll provide a free estimate after assessing the damage on-site.

Q: How do I prevent water damage in my home or business?

Regular maintenance and inspections can help prevent water damage. Check your pipes, appliances, and roofs regularly for signs of wear and tear. Consider installing a sump pump or water detector to alert you to potential issues.
